// Fixture for the Keyspindle rotation utility's dry-run mode.
// Support folks: this simulates a rotation cycle against the fake
// Orlin vault backend without touching production material. The
// fixture seeds three expiring credentials and one already-revoked
// entry so the cleanup path is exercised. If a customer reports a
// stuck rotation, replay this fixture first before escalating to the
// platform team. The harness authenticates to the mock vault with a
// static bearer token, which appears on the next line.

login token, yawig-kagaf: eyJhbGciOiJIUzI1NiIsInR5cCI6IkpXVCJ9.eyJzdWIiOiIlAlfV7MEnpIn0.t7OupPTrg_dn

## Loyalty Ledger Basics (Pointwise)

Welcome aboard! The points ledger is append-only — never edit rows, ever. Adjustments go in as compensating entries via the `ledger-adjust` job. If balances look wrong, first check whether the nightly reconciler (Tallyhawk) has run; it's usually just lag. Negative balances are allowed briefly during refunds, so don't panic. Escalate to the Ledger Guild channel only after reconciliation completes. The full reconciliation walkthrough, with screenshots, lives on our internal wiki page.

runbook for badug-kadup: https://confluence.zemvarlabs.internal/projects/browse/display/projects/bd1b

UserSplit Cutover Drift: the extracted account service and the legacy Marigold monolith user module are reporting divergent record counts during dual-write. This fires when drift exceeds 0.5% over 15 minutes. New team members should not replay writes manually. Reconciliation steps and the rollback procedure are documented on the internal page.

wiki page, tajog-fafog: https://gitlab.paliqsys.corp/dash/display/job/853dd6fcbf54

Handover Note — Q2 Cash-Flow Forecast

For the board, prepared during the transition from Director Aldwyn to Director Preece. The quarterly forecast assumes steady receipts from the Marwick contracts and a one-off outflow for the Fenholt warehouse works in May. Sensitivity runs show adequate headroom under all modelled scenarios. Director Preece should review the assumptions register before sign-off. The strategic backdrop is summarised below.

confidential, kagep-kahof: Druokax Systems plans to lower the Ulaath list price by 53 percent in March.